Army Commanders meet to begin in New Delhi from Monday

The Army Commander's Conference will start from Monday, in New Delhi. The Six day Conference will appraise current and emerging strategic security scenario, review of operational preparedness of the Indian Army and aspects pertaining to training, administration, military technology and force modernisation. <br/><br/>Defence minister Manohar Parrikar will address this high level Army Conference on first day. The Conference will be chaired by Chief of the Army Staff, Gen Dalbir Singh. All Army Commanders and other senior Army Officers will attend the conference. There will be a structured interaction with senior officials of the MoD including the Defence Secretary.
